I prefer Star Trek to Star Wars Star Wars is a saga of knights in space cloaks (no pejorative) and Star Trek is a story where all known races have made peace and explore the unknown together There are all skin tones on board and aliens and humans It's not the center of the universe where robots, planets communicate with whales, Klingons complain that human women are ugly, and God doesn't exist. God is just an alien prisoner. The so-called heaven is a false space-time zone, and there is still the Force in Star Wars. ancient nature mystical power

Peace and exploration are our future
